What is the volume of a cylinder with a height of 16.5 m and a base with a radius of 8.9 m, to the nearest tenth of a cubic meter?

Answer:[tex]V=4106.48\ m^3[/tex]

Step-by-step explanation:

Given

height of cylinder [tex]h=16.5\ m[/tex]

base of radius is [tex]r=8.9\ m[/tex]

Now volume of cylinder is given by

[tex]V=\pi r^2h[/tex]

[tex]V=\pi (8.9)^2(16.5)[/tex]

[tex]V=1306.965\pi [/tex]

[tex]V=4106.48\ m^3[/tex]
